Transaction 70e95dce3a24aae5c99ee54f6532307b7dc3574e4f7af890fd38e25b3fb295bf

1 Input
2 Outputs
  • 70e95dce3a24aae5c99ee54f6532307b7dc3574e4f7af890fd38e25b3fb295bf:0
  • value  1460693923
    address  bc1qhknrqq9nkxhslx37afyn3u6kjf2hp4w4vr8rds
  • 70e95dce3a24aae5c99ee54f6532307b7dc3574e4f7af890fd38e25b3fb295bf:1
  • value  399600
    address  3QaqJhbviSMtxs42DdyQv6xjYNoQsFurYL